Details
ui: Refactor models store, MCP service, and gate logs behind VITE_DEBUG (#23236)
-
refactor: Scope console logs to
DEV+VITE_DEBUGenv vars -
refactor: skip MCP proxy probe when no server requires it
-
refactor: suppress expected disconnect errors during MCP client shutdown
-
refactor: Deduplicate requests
-
refactor: deduplicate model fetching across ROUTER and MODEL modes
-
refactor: Clean up models logic
-
chore: Add
.env.examplefile -
refactor: replace client-side CORS proxy probe with server status flag
-
refactor: Post-review fixes
-
test: add vitest client setup with API fetch mocks
macOS/iOS:
- macOS Apple Silicon (arm64)
- macOS Apple Silicon (arm64, KleidiAI enabled)
- macOS Intel (x64)
- iOS XCFramework
Linux:
- Ubuntu x64 (CPU)
- Ubuntu arm64 (CPU)
- Ubuntu s390x (CPU)
- Ubuntu x64 (Vulkan)
- Ubuntu arm64 (Vulkan)
- Ubuntu x64 (ROCm 7.2)
- Ubuntu x64 (OpenVINO)
- Ubuntu x64 (SYCL FP32)
- Ubuntu x64 (SYCL FP16)
Android:
Windows:
- Windows x64 (CPU)
- Windows arm64 (CPU)
- Windows x64 (CUDA 12) - CUDA 12.4 DLLs
- Windows x64 (CUDA 13) - CUDA 13.1 DLLs
- Windows x64 (Vulkan)
- Windows x64 (SYCL)
- Windows x64 (HIP)
openEuler: